Fix cannot find package "golang.org/x/net/context"
2017-08-26 23:08
555 查看
在使用bleve这款全文检索引擎的时候,(备注:bleve的 读音 可以使用汉语“布拉维”)出现了一些错误,一些依赖包找不到,导致无法继续,下面做一些详细说明。
$
上述方案未奏效,无法下载,结果显示
说明,在src目录下创建目录,如:
在x目录下,进行克隆仓库 $
再次尝试编译,此问题被解决
https://github.com/beego/admin/issues/55
编译错误信息
cannot find package "golang.org/x/net/context" in any of: .../projects/go-projects/src/github.com/blevesearch/bleve/vendor/golang.org/x/net/context (vendor tree) /usr/local/go/src/golang.org/x/net/context (from $GOROOT) .../projects/go-projects/src/golang.org/x/net/context (from $GOPATH)
尝试性解决
$go get golang.org/x/net/...
$
go get golang.org/x/net/context
上述方案未奏效,无法下载,结果显示
timeout超时
最终解决方案
cd src mkdir golang.org cd golang.org mkdir x cd x git clone git@github.com:golang/net.git --depth 1
说明,在src目录下创建目录,如:
src/golang.org/x/
在x目录下,进行克隆仓库 $
git clone git@github.com:golang/net.git --depth 1
再次尝试编译,此问题被解决
参考
https://github.com/blevesearch/bleve/issues/624https://github.com/beego/admin/issues/55
相关文章推荐
- Fix cannot find package "golang.org/x/net/context"
- Fix cannot find package "golang.org/x/text/unicode/norm"
- cannot find package "golang.org/x/text/..." 或者"golang.org/x/net/..."的解决方法
- cannot find package "golang.org/x/net/proxy"
- ASP.NET CORE MVC 2.0 项目中引用第三方DLL报错的解决办法 - InvalidOperationException: Cannot find compilation library location for package
- go程序包源码解读——golang.org/x/net/context
- Caused by: java.lang.ClassNotFoundException: Didn't find class "net.oschina.app.AppContext" on path:
- Cannot find bean: "org.apache.struts.taglib.html.BEAN" in any scope 问题
- go get报错unrecognized import path “golang.org/x/net/context”…
- Eclipse:Cannot find the class file for org.apache.http.Header. Fix the build path then try building
- [GO] mac cannot find package "fmt"
- Cannot find bean: "org.apache.struts.taglib.html.BEAN" in any scope
- how to fix "Cannot find a valid baseurl for repo: poptop-stable/7" in centos 7 *64 when use "yum -y
- cannot find package "github.com/as/structslice"
- golang中如何安装/导入类似"golang.org/x/net/html"的包
- Cannot find bean: "org.apache.struts.taglib.html.BEAN" in any scope
- Import "golang.org/x/net/icmp" failed! , go语言(golang)导入Import "golang.org/x/net/icmp" failed!包失败
- org.apache.jasper.JasperException: Cannot find bean: "list" in any scope
- revel安装报错unrecognized import path "golang.org/x/net/websocket"
- <context:component-scan base-package=""> 与 <context:annotation-config 区别